Transaction df80c5cb3ea573126eaa1b4bbf5a5fa44b65ea2575d429a2bb0bac94fe205124
1 Input
1 Output
-
df80c5cb3ea573126eaa1b4bbf5a5fa44b65ea2575d429a2bb0bac94fe205124:0
- value
- 73110
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 40c14ae98d6c36b453f7443909f1a0309c9840d40579a6e1b7aef458e4867cde
- address
- bc1pgrq546vddsmtg5lhgsusnudqxzwfssx5q4u6dcdh4m693eyx0n0q3xm95m